I talk a lot about the Sin Management approach to the Christian life. Actually, I talk a lot against the Sin Management approach. This approach says that I am responsible to manage and control the sin in my life. It sounds responsible; it sounds logical; and it is desirable because it allows me to retain a sense of control. But it doesn’t work consistently. The Grace/Spirit Life approach says that God alone has the power to give me a new nature, a new heart and a new mind. I am to depend upon His power alone for victory over sin. And there is one other none too subtle difference. The Grace/Spirit Life approach does work.
